0 reports about 8163362380The number was first reported 31st Jul, 2025
Received a phone call from 8163362380? Report here
File a report about 8163362380 |
Phone Number Variations: 8163362380, 0816-3362380, 918163362380, 008163362380, 1918163362380, +1918163362380